Javascript-форум (https://javascript.ru/forum/)
-   Events/DOM/Window (https://javascript.ru/forum/events/)
-   -   Замена текста (https://javascript.ru/forum/events/56111-zamena-teksta.html)

Telnet 30.05.2015 13:21

Замена текста
 
Всем привет
Прошу Вашей помощи есть вот такая строка
<image transform="matrix(1,0,0,1,0,0)" preserveAspectRatio="none" x="97" y="0" width="411" height="437" xlink:href="/images/1.png"></image><image transform="matrix(1,0,0,1,0,0)" preserveAspectRatio="none" x="97" y="0" width="411" height="437" xlink:href="/images/2.png"></image>

Мне нужно в начало ссылок на изображение добавить имя домена типа что б стало так
<image transform="matrix(1,0,0,1,0,0)" preserveAspectRatio="none" x="97" y="0" width="411" height="437" xlink:href="http://javascript.ru/images/1.png"></image><image transform="matrix(1,0,0,1,0,0)" preserveAspectRatio="none" x="97" y="0" width="411" height="437" xlink:href="http://javascript.ru/images/2.png"></image>

indeterm 30.05.2015 13:35

console.log(

'<image transform="matrix(1,0,0,1,0,0)" preserveAspectRatio="none" x="97" y="0" width="411" height="437" xlink:href="/images/1.png"></image><image transform="matrix(1,0,0,1,0,0)" preserveAspectRatio="none" x="97" y="0" width="411" height="437" xlink:href="/images/2.png"></image>'

.replace(/(xlink:href=")/g, '$1http://javascript.ru')
)


//>>>> <image transform="matrix(1,0,0,1,0,0)" preserveAspectRatio="none" x="97" y="0" width="411" height="437" xlink:href="http://javascript.ru/images/1.png"></image><image transform="matrix(1,0,0,1,0,0)" preserveAspectRatio="none" x="97" y="0" width="411" height="437" xlink:href="http://javascript.ru/images/2.png"></image>


Часовой пояс GMT +3, время: 02:26.